Разработка сайта, какая статья? - коротко
Разработка сайта включает несколько этапов: анализ требований, дизайн, программирование и тестирование. В зависимости от сложности проекта могут потребоваться дополнительные статьи, такие как маркетинг и SEO оптимизация.
Разработка сайта, какая статья? - развернуто
Разработка сайта представляет собой сложный и многоэтапный процесс, включающий в себя несколько ключевых стадий. Каждая из этих стадий имеет свою уникальную роль и значение для конечного результата.
Во-первых, необходимо провести анализ требований и потребностей клиента. Этот этап включает в себя сбор информации о целях и задачах проекта, а также об ожиданиях клиента относительно функциональности и дизайна сайта. На этом этапе важно учесть все детали, чтобы избежать возможных проблем на последующих стадиях разработки.
Во-вторых, следует создание технического задания (ТЗ). ТЗ является основным документом, который описывает все аспекты проекта, включая функциональные и нефункциональные требования. Этот документ служит основой для дальнейшей работы команды разработчиков и дизайнеров.
Третий этап включает в себя разработку структуры и макетов сайта. На этом этапе дизайнеры создают визуальные прототипы страниц, которые затем согласуются с клиентом. Важно учитывать пользовательский опыт (UX) и интерфейс пользователя (UI), чтобы сайт был удобным и привлекательным для посетителей.
Четвертый этап - это непосредственно программирование и разработка сайта. В этом процессе используются различные технологии и инструменты, такие как HTML, CSS, JavaScript, а также серверные языки программирования и базы данных. Важно обеспечить высокую производительность и безопасность сайта, чтобы избежать возможных уязвимостей и проблем с работой ресурса.
Пятый этап - тестирование и отладка. На этом этапе необходимо проверить все функции сайта, чтобы убедиться в их корректной работе. Это включает в себя как автоматизированное тестирование, так и ручное проверки всех возможных сценариев использования.
Шестой этап - развертывание сайта на хостинге. Это включает в себя выбор подходящего хостинга, настройку сервера и базы данных, а также перенос всех файлов сайта на удаленный сервер. Важно обеспечить стабильность и доступность ресурса для пользователей.
Наконец, седьмой этап - это сопровождение и обновление сайта. Это включает в себя мониторинг работы сайта, обновление контента, исправление возможных ошибок и добавление новых функций по мере необходимости. Регулярное обслуживание и поддержка помогают поддерживать высокий уровень качества и безопасности сайта.
Таким образом, разработка сайта является многогранным процессом, требующим координации усилий различных специалистов и строгого соблюдения всех этапов для достижения оптимального результата.